Abstract
Component technology is only available for business-oriented quality of service (QoS) management functions, can not satisfy the QoS requirements of soft real-time applications areas such as the multimedia and Web services. For real-time guarantee and improving resource utilization needs, this paper presents a real-time scheduling model for soft real-time component-oriented systems. First, the task model, component QoS specifications, resources container, resources container manager, and scheduler-related factors and their mutual relations are described. Second, the method for adding real-time mechanism to the component system is given. Finally, the scheduling algorithm is extended based on this model, and the resource container management algorithms are given, including access control algorithm, out of control algorithm, and QoS negotiation algorithm. The model meets the real-time requirements of applications and improves the system resource utilization together.
